DevOps Engineer

TLDR

Manage and implement cloud infrastructure for diverse clients in the video game industry, leveraging Kubernetes and Infrastructure-as-Code tooling to optimize performance.

  • 4 to 7 years experience as a DevOps engineer
  • Extensive experience with Linux
  • Extensive experience with container orchestration using Kubernetes
  • Experience with Self-hosted Kubernetes clusters administration
  • GCP or AWS cloud experience
  • Experience with Infrastructure-as-Code tooling
  • Experience with Python / Bash scripting
  • Experience with observability tools
  • Experience with CI/CD
  • Excellent interpersonal communication skills
  • Strong communication skills
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Responsibilities
  • Manage Kubernetes clusters (self-hosted or cloud-based)
  • Implement and maintenance infrastructure in the cloud
  • Managing Linux servers, web servers and application servers
  • Configuration management (puppet, ansible)
  • Manage Infrastructure as a code (terraform/terragrunt)
  • Troubleshooting
